This hostel is simply way too big and massified. While it is well equipped with everything you need, if you're looking for a nice, cozy, friendly atmosphere, this is not the place to go. The rooms were abit dirty, but the shared bathrooms looked liek they had just been renoavted & were quite good & always clean. The bar was good with lots of cheap drinks which always helps when your on a budget! Staff were pleasent & helpful, overall quite a good hostel. more
